Brief Summary

Chronic kidney disease (CKD) is a significant public health issue in Egypt, leading to end-stage renal disease (ESRD). ESRD patients often suffer from oral abnormalities due to the disease and medications. Periodontitis is linked to systemic diseases, including renal disease, with inflammation playing a key role. TLR4 genetic variations may influence susceptibility to CKD and periodontitis. This study investigates the association between TLR4 \[Gly/Thr (rs2149356)\] polymorphism and chronic periodontal disease in ESRD patients in Egypt.

Outcome Measures

Primary Outcomes (1)

  • Clinical Attachment Level (CAL):

    Description: The CAL measures the extent of periodontal support around a tooth, from the cementoenamel junction (CEJ) to the base of the pocket, crucial for diagnosing periodontal disease. Measurement Method: CAL is recorded using a periodontal probe by measuring probing depth (PD) and distance from the gingival margin to the CEJ. CAL is calculated as follows: CEJ at gingival margin: CAL = PD Gingival margin coronal to CEJ: CAL = PD - Distance from Gingival Margin to CEJ Gingival margin apical to CEJ: CAL = PD + Distance from CEJ to Gingival Margin in non- periodontitis individuals CAL is zero

Study Arms (2)

Healthy Subjects with Periodontitis

Description: This group consists of 50 systemically healthy individuals diagnosed with periodontitis. Participants are of both genders, aged between 30 and 60 years. They have Periodontitis stage II and/or stage III and do not have any history of systemic diseases or long-term medication use. All smokers were excluded from this group. Interventions of Interest: Clinical assessment of periodontal parameters such as Plaque Index (PI), Gingival Index (GI), Probing Depth (PD), and Clinical Attachment Level (CAL) using standard methods. Evaluation of the proportion of bleeding sites as a Bleeding on Probing (BOP) score.

ESRD Patients with Periodontitis

Description: This group includes 50 individuals diagnosed with end-stage renal disease (ESRD) who are on regular hemodialysis. Participants are of both genders, aged between 30 and 60 years, and unrelated Egyptians from similar socioeconomic statuses residing in the same geographical area. They also suffer from Periodontitis stage II and/or stage III. All participants have underlying type 2 diabetes mellitus. Exclusions include those with kidney transplants, other systemic diseases except diabetes, history of malignancy, and smokers. Interventions of Interest: Clinical assessment of periodontal parameters similar to Group I, including PI, GI, PD, and CAL. Analysis of genetic variations in the TLR4 gene through blood sample collection and DNA extraction. SNP genotyping in the TLR4 gene performed using Real Time Polymerase Chain Reaction (RT-PCR).
